
Arrest of Tren de Aragua Gang Member in Chicago
In a significant development, the U.S. Marshals Service has apprehended a fugitive member of the Tren de Aragua gang, Ricardo Gonzalez, in connection with heinous crimes committed in Chicago. This arrest comes as a result of a concerted effort by law enforcement to tackle gang violence and criminal activities in urban areas. Gonzalez is wanted for two counts of murder and kidnapping, making his capture a crucial step in ensuring community safety.
Details of the Crimes
According to police reports, Gonzalez is accused of kidnapping three women and subsequently taking them to an alley in Chicago, where he allegedly shot them in the head. Tragically, two of the women were killed in this brutal attack. The Tren de Aragua Gang
The Tren de Aragua gang, originally from Venezuela, has gained notoriety for its involvement in various criminal enterprises, including drug trafficking, extortion, and violent crimes. The gang’s expansion into the United States poses significant challenges for law enforcement agencies, as they often operate across state lines and engage in brutal tactics to assert control over territories.
